Tobias Harris (Detroit Pistons) Over 18.5 Points + Rebounds (-120)

Odds available at fanduel at time of publishing

Tobias Harris is poised for a standout performance against the Brooklyn Nets, and targeting him for over 18.5 points and rebounds feels like a solid play. In his last three away games, Harris has been a man on a mission, hitting this mark in every outing. He's averaged nearly 15.8 points and 7.6 rebounds on the road recently, and against the Nets, he's found extra motivation, averaging 16 points and 6.8 rebounds in their last clashes. With the Nets' defensive lapses, Harris could exploit mismatches all night. The numbers suggest a strong upward trajectory-his expected stat value of 21.64 paints a clear picture of his capability to exceed this mark. As he continues to flourish away from home and with a perfect hit rate in his last three games, betting on Harris to surpass 18.5 points and rebounds seems more than reasonable; it's downright enticing.

Jalen Duren (Detroit Pistons) Under 18.5 Points + Assists (-120)

Odds available at fanduel at time of publishing

As Jalen Duren prepares to take the floor against the Brooklyn Nets, the smart money seems to lean toward the under on his combined points and assists, set at 18.5. Recently, Duren has averaged just 12.8 points and 3.6 assists over his last five games, which clearly positions him well below this threshold. When he's on the road, those numbers dip further to 11.4 points and 3 assists. What's particularly telling is his recent success against the Nets; he's averaged only 12.6 points and 3.4 assists in their last matchups. Given that Duren has hit the under in 12 of his last 14 games and has a perfect record away from home in his last six outings, it's hard to see him breaking out of this trend. Expect a disciplined defensive effort from Brooklyn to further limit his contributions, making the under on Duren a compelling play.
